ALBANY, New York, Jan. 28 -- Gov. Andrew Cuomo, D-New York, issued the following news release on Jan. 27:
Earlier, Governor Andrew M. Cuomo attended the official commemoration of the 75th anniversary of the liberation of Nazi concentration and extermination camp Auschwitz-Birkenau. The Governor joined world leaders as the only U.S. elected official to attend the official commemoration events (http://auschwitz.org/en/schedule-of-events75/#_blank).
